This year’s NTRA National Horseplayers Championship (NHC), which kicks off Friday, March 14 at Horseshoe Las Vegas, will have a record 800 entries and record cash and prizes totaling $4,878,415, including more than $3 million in cash prizes. Junior Alvarado’s two dramatic graded stakes wins in the Canadian Turf and Fountain of Youth at Gulfstream Park on Fountain of Youth Day earned the native of Venezuela Jockey of the Week by a vote of racing experts for the week of February 24 through March 2. Santa Anita Derby (G1) winner and Kentucky Derby (G1) runner-up Journalism will be entered in the $2 million Preakness Stakes (G1) at Pimlico Race Course May 17, co-owners Eclipse Thoroughbred Partners confirmed May 11.
